Job summary

Would you like to work in the community? Do you want a new challenge?Come and join our Integrated Care Team -Therapy.

We have a full-time Senior Therapy Assistant vacancy to work in a community therapy team in the West of the City. The Team treats adults over 16 referred from the Hospital, GPs, District Nurses, and other Health and Social Care services with a variety of conditions and therapy needs to maintaining and improve independent living.

The successful candidate will deliver rehabilitation programmes and provide equipment to patients within the home environment. You will work alongside occupational therapist, physiotherapists and specialist therapy assistants to progress rehabilitation and improve independence.

We work in an integrated way with the nursing teams to achieve the patient goals in a patient centred way. Staff are well supported with regular team meeting, supervision and training.

Main duties of the job

To assist the interdisciplinary team in the provision of patient centred care.

To implement packages of care and rehabilitation programmes in the community and complete patient records.

Undertake assessment of patients within departmental guidelines.

To assist the interdisciplinary team in maintaining an efficient working environment.

Person Specification

Qualifications

Essential

  • Educated to GCSE grade 4/C or above in English and Maths or equivalent
  • Level III NVQ in Health and Social Care/ OR diagnostic and therapeutic support or equivalent relevant qualification /experience
  • Demonstrate commitment to life long learning via personal development file

Desirable

  • IT training/qualifications or equivalent

Special Skills/Aptitudes

Essential

  • Due to the requirement to undertake visits and transport non-portable equipment, the post holder is required to be either car driver with a valid driving licence, or have access to an alternative means of transport

Experience

Essential

  • Relevant experience of either, working in rehabilitation e.g. as a therapy assistant or a rehabilitation assistant/ assistant practitioner or another rehabilitation setting
  • To have worked independently managing own patient/client list
  • Experience of liaising with other agencies, services and professional colleagues

Desirable

  • To have worked in the community setting

Further Training

Essential

  • Be able to assess, implement and assist in rehabilitation programmes
  • Good verbal and non-verbal communicator with the ability to motivate people
  • To understand and practice confidentiality
  • To have developed coping strategies to deal with the emotional nature of the work
  • To have prioritisation skills to independently manage own workload
  • Flexible to meet the needs of the service
  • Computer literate

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.

Certificate of Sponsorship

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
